Truck crash kills 19 in northern China
Published: November 5, 2009
BEIJING (AP) — State media has reported that at least 19 people were killed after a truck crashed into a crowd of people on the side of a road in northern China.
The official Xinhua News Agency says the accident in a rural area of Hebei province happened after dusk Thursday when the truck hit another vehicle and then crashed into the crowd.
No reason was given for the accident, which left an additional 13 people in hospital. Road accidents are common in China because of overloaded and unsafe vehicles, poor road conditions and bad driving habits.
